Definitions

This page discusses the citizenship status and place of birth of the residents of Campus Highlands. In all cases, including citizenship status, the results are based solely on survey responses and were not further verified.

  • Citizen, US-Born: a person that was born in the United States, excluding Puerto Rico and other outlying areas
  • Citizen, Territory-Born: born in Puerto-Rico or a US outlying area
  • Citizen, Born Abroad: born abroad of American parents
  • Citizen, Naturalized: not a citizen at birth, but has become one since
  • Not Citizen: foreign born non-citizen, regardless of formal immigration status

These definition were taken directly from the US Census Bureau, and reflect respondents status at the time of the survey.

Unlike the other geographical entities detailed on this site, neighborhoods are not recognized by the U.S. Census Bureau. To overcome this we have computed reasonable estimates of the same statistics that are presented for other the entity types. Each statistic is computed as the weighted sum or average of the census tracts or block groups that overlap the neighborhood. A weighted sum is used for counts of people or households, and a weighted average is used for statistics that are themselves some form of average, such as median household income. Census block groups are preferred when the statistic in question is available on the block group level. The weight for a given tract (or block group) is computed as the population of the census tabulation blocks that occupy the intersection between the tract and the neighborhood as a fraction of the total population of the neighborhood.
